I have just moved into a house which has been empty for some time. The slabs on the patio are green and very slippery when wet. I assume thta this is some form of algae. What is the best way to remove this and clean the slabs up?

If you dont have a pressure washer,another method is to wash them with Jeyes Fluid.You may have to use a stiff brush or a deck scrubber,which can be hard work if you have a lot of slabs to wash.
